Alright, let's get down to business. Soon after the game began, the Clippers showed amazing attacking power. And while the Pacers were pretty good on the offensive end — they still had a one-point lead at the end of the first quarter — they were a bit leaky defensively.

Then things took a turn for the worse. The Clippers found their rhythm and gradually widened the gap with stars like Leonard and Harden. By the time the whistle blew in the first half, the Clippers had led the Pacers by 11 points, 77-66.

After returning in the second half, the Clippers didn't let up in the slightest. In particular, Harden scored 21 points in the third quarter alone! Isn't it great? And Harden was efficient throughout the game -- 35 points and 9 assists! George and Leonard were not idle: 27 and 28 points were solid.
